The most common form, where the handle is exposed on the outside.
2. Low Profile/Shallow Type:
With a lower overall height, this type is suitable for areas with limited space.
3. Locking Type:
The handle features a central locking hole that can be secured with a padlock or an integrated key lock to prevent unauthorized opening.
4. Materials:
Common materials include zinc alloy die-casting (strong and durable), stainless steel (corrosion-resistant), and plastic/nylon (lightweight, rust-resistant, and cost-effective).
